To follow >> my suggestion he would need to have the dataset created when the package >> was installed (or the binary was built). and now John can use the data() "trick" Ivan recommended *if* John builds his source tar ball using R CMD build --no-resave-data *and* puts the code that creates the R object into a <his_pkg>/data/myRobj.R file *and* adds a data(myRobj) into his .onLoad() hook. This would *not* create the object at package installation time but each time the package is loaded .. which is at least only once for all the examples in R CMD check <his_pkg> OTOH, I do agree with you Duncan, that in this case your suggestion seems preferable and we add the R code which creates the object somewhere "nakedly" in <his_pkg>/R/zzz.R {zzz: to be alphabetically last} and hence the object would live (hidden) in his_pkg namespace. He'd ideally also provide an *exported* function, say myData <- function(name = "<name_of_his_object>") get(name, asNamespace("<his_pkg>")) and then would use myData() {or myData(".....") } in his package examples. ______________________________________________ R-package-devel@r-project.org mailing list https://stat.ethz.ch/mailman/listinfo/r-package-devel
